How they compare
Kazakhstan currently reports 1,165 against 1,059 in Ecuador, a difference of 106.
That makes Kazakhstan's figure about 1.1 times Ecuador's.
Across all 11 years both countries report, Kazakhstan has been ahead every year.
Ecuador ranks 55th and Kazakhstan ranks 54th of 144 countries.
Kazakhstan has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ecuador | Kazakhstan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 283 | 796 | 513 | Kazakhstan |
| 1970s | 370 | 956 | 586 | Kazakhstan |
| 1980s | 539 | 1,088 | 549 | Kazakhstan |
| 1990s | 766 | 1,387 | 621 | Kazakhstan |
| 2000s | 941 | 1,079 | 138 | Kazakhstan |
| 2010s | 1,059 | 1,165 | 106 | Kazakhstan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
